About the Role
Pickware is developing a new business platform for selling our products, enabling customers to manage licenses, master data, payment methods, and users. As a TypeScript Backend Developer, you will take on the following responsibilities:
- Conception and implementation of new features
- Maintenance and care of the platform
- Conducting bug fixes
- Independent coordination of requirements with product managers
- Writing clean and maintainable code
- Taking responsibility for the quality of your work
About the Candidate
What you bring:
- Completed studies in Computer Science or comparable education
- Passion for programming with a high standard of quality
- Relevant professional experience in Software Development is beneficial, but entry-level candidates are welcome
- Very good knowledge of TypeScript
- Solid knowledge of Node.js and Express
- Experience with NestJS is a plus
- Familiarity with ORMs (e.g., TypeORM) and relational database systems (e.g., PostgreSQL)
- Nice to have: Experience in frontend development and knowledge of Vue.js
- Good communication skills with the ability to serve as a competent internal point of contact for the sales platform
- Ability to understand business processes
- Excellent German and English skills, both verbal and written
About the Company
Pickware is a leading software manufacturer specializing in the innovation of inventory management, shipping, and checkout solutions for Shopify and Shopware. Our motto is 'Making Online Trading Easy.' With over 1,100 merchants relying on our software, including renowned names like Pegador and Alpha Industries, we focus on efficiency and seamless process automation.
